<span style="color: #222222;">Sikkim reported two new COVID-19 cases today. DG-cum-Secretary of Health Dr Pempa T. Bhutia informed that total COVID19 cases in the state stands at 70, of which 66 are active and four people have been discharged after recovery.</span><br />'' <span style="color: #222222;">&nbsp;</span><br />'' <span style="color: #222222;">The two new cases include an 18-year-old female returnee from New Delhi who was in facility quarantine in Pelling, West Sikkim. She has been shifted to Ayush Hospital, Geyzing.</span><br />'' <span style="color: #222222;">&nbsp; </span><br />'' <span style="color: #222222;">The other person is a 52-year-old male from Tathangchen, Gangtok, who returned from Kolkata. He was admitted to STNM Hospital near Gangtok with flu like symptoms on 15th June.</span><br />'' <span style="color: #222222;">&nbsp; </span><br />'' <span style="color: #222222;">Mr Bhutia also informed about the death of a 27-year-old man on 16th June. He had returned to Sikkim from New Delhi on 5th June and had been placed in facility quarantine in Gangtok. He developed flu-like symptoms and tested negative for COVID19 three times before being diagnosed with tuberculosis. He was prescribed medication for tuberculosis and was discharged from facility quarantine, but developed complications on 16th June. He was rushed to Central Referral Hospital, Gangtok, where he was declared dead. Dr. Bhutia informed that the sample was again RTPCR tested for final confirmation, which was also negative.</span><br />'' &nbsp;
